Sat 704886863396721

decimal
140977.1863396721
degree
0°140977′1873″1863396721‴
percentile
33.56604115105223%
name
ivxrlehpmpk
cycle
0
epoch
0
period
69
block
140977
offset
1863396721
timestamp
rarity
common